9baf9f5c4b Use build args for git user config
Change git configuration to use Docker build args instead of .env file,
simplifying setup and improving security. This change:
- Removes git config from .env and startup.sh
- Adds GIT_USER_NAME and GIT_USER_EMAIL build args
- Updates documentation for new git config approach
- Improves task logging requirements in CLAUDE.md

The build arg approach provides better isolation and ensures git config is
properly set during image build rather than container runtime.

9d1f8d0661 Add git user configuration support
Add required git user configuration to enable commits from within the container.
This change ensures proper attribution of git commits made inside the container by:

- Adding GIT_USER_NAME and GIT_USER_EMAIL to .env.example
- Configuring git user globally during Docker build
- Adding documentation for git configuration requirements
- Updating README with clearer setup instructions and requirements

The configuration is now required as part of the initial setup to prevent
issues with unattributed commits when using git inside the container.

066233b03c Add modular system package installation support
Implemented SYSTEM_PACKAGES environment variable for flexible system library installation:

Key Features:
- Users specify packages in .env: SYSTEM_PACKAGES="libopenslide0 libgdal-dev"
- Packages installed during Docker build (secure, no runtime mounting)
- Automatic rebuild detection when packages change
- Documentation with common scientific computing packages

Technical Implementation:
- ARG SYSTEM_PACKAGES in Dockerfile with conditional apt-get install
- Build argument passed from claude-docker.sh script
- Clean package management with cache cleanup

Benefits:
- Secure: No system directory mounting required
- Flexible: Users choose exactly what they need
- Documented: Common packages listed in README
- Clean: Packages baked into image, not mounted at runtime

Tested successfully with OpenSlide: conda run -n prism python -c "import openslide"

a53d28bf2f Add comprehensive conda integration for academic environments
Enhanced conda support to handle custom environment and package directories:

Key Changes:
- Mount conda installation at original path (not /opt/miniconda3)
- Add CONDA_EXTRA_DIRS for mounting additional search paths
- Mount all conda-configured directories to preserve existing setup
- Update CLAUDE.md to use ${CONDA_EXE} environment variable

Technical Details:
- Preserves original conda paths so existing configuration works
- Handles multiple envs_dirs and pkgs_dirs automatically
- Provides feedback about which directories are mounted
- Falls back gracefully for missing directories

Example usage: CONDA_EXTRA_DIRS="/vol/path/.conda/envs /vol/path/conda_envs /vol/path/.conda/pkgs"
Result: All conda environments and packages accessible in container.

7cd765b756 Implement zero-friction authentication persistence with MCP user scope
Major breakthrough solving the authentication chicken-and-egg problem:

Key Changes:
- Copy ~/.claude.json and ~/.claude/ during Docker build for baked-in auth
- Add -s user flag to claude mcp add-json for persistent MCP servers
- Simplify rebuild logic to prevent unnecessary rebuilds
- Update documentation with rebuild instructions

Technical Details:
- Authentication files placed before USER switch in Dockerfile
- MCP configuration now persists across all sessions
- Rebuild only occurs when image doesn't exist
- Clean separation of build vs runtime concerns

Result: Users authenticate once on host, then zero login prompts forever.
SMS notifications ready immediately on container start.
